Here are the only tools I used to create great looking T-shirts just like this one (for Christmas) for our own Internet boutique here at the n10ah Online Music Network.
- A quality color printer
- A 4-megapixel Minolta digital camera
- A pair of scissors
- A few sheets of white construction paper
- A box of crayons
- Some volunteer help
- A couple of hours set aside on two weekends
The tools you use may differ based on your talents and materials available, but remember resourcefulness is the key.
